Styling and Maintenance Tips

Pair a modern lehenga with statement earrings or a cropped blouse for proportion. Add a light jacket for depth without bulk. Keep the dupatta pleated or clipped for ease of movement. Most embellished fabrics need gentle dry cleaning and proper folding before storage or travel.

Frequently Asked Questions

What makes a lehenga modern?

A modern lehenga updates traditional cuts with lighter fabrics, minimal embroidery, or contemporary blouse styles like capes or jackets.

Which fabric is best for a modern lehenga?

Georgette, rayon, and tissue are popular for their drape, comfort, and suitability for digital or textured prints.

Can a modern lehenga be worn for a wedding?

Yes, many brides and guests choose modern lehengas with fusion silhouettes and subtle embellishments for wedding events.

How should I accessorize a modern lehenga?

Use statement earrings, metallic heels, and a compact clutch. Keep jewelry balanced to highlight the outfit’s pattern or embroidery.

Are modern lehengas suitable for travel?

Lightweight printed or georgette lehengas pack easily and resist wrinkles, making them ideal for destination or outstation events.
